Anybody here a fan of the new musical Spring Awakening? I haven't seen it, but I just got the cd cause my friends suggested it and it is amazing. Of course i know people here might not be into musical theatre, but this album only is a good listen. The story is basically being a teenager under strict German rule and braking the rules and having your way (songs about having sex with the teacher, getting girls pregnant, changing the system, masturbation, and a whole bunch of biblical refrences, etc.). is a link to a youtube video of the cast at the Tony Awards. I highly suggest it! What are your thoughts.

Actually They are questioning the bible! And why are you responding to a thread about a musical... when you don't like musicals? The show was based on the original play Spring Awakening. The music can be found at the Zune Marketplace as well. The writer of the songs also has his own personal albums. The musical is new in a way that it looks old but feels very modern. The music is mostly rock and the lyrics are very provocative. At the same time of being obscene its provoking. Like how everything during that time period of 1891 is strictly under rule over the elders and what is right and wrong is depicted in the bible. These teenagers are going against the norm.
